Comprehending the Legal Distinctions
The UK Gambling Commission enforces rigorous standards that govern every aspect of digital gaming, from bonus structures to betting caps and self-exclusion schemes. Meanwhile, platforms operating under non uk casinos typically follow licensing frameworks from regions like Malta, Curacao, or Gibraltar, which often impose less stringent requirements. These licensing differences create different outcomes for players, with external operators frequently offering higher betting limits and more generous promotional terms that domestic operators cannot provide.
British players exploring non uk casinos encounter varying safeguard mechanisms compared to local operators, though many non-UK providers still maintain robust player safeguards. Jurisdictions such as Malta Gaming Authority offer detailed regulation while allowing operators increased latitude in designing their gambling services. The absence of certain UK-specific restrictions, like mandatory deposit limits and reality checks, appeals to seasoned players who prefer managing their own gambling behavior without enforced interventions.
Tax treatment constitutes another critical regulatory distinction, as non uk casinos operating from particular locations may organize their services differently regarding player returns and running expenses. UK-licensed casinos must adhere to point-of-consumption tax regulations, which can influence the competitiveness of their reward programs and gaming options. Understanding these fundamental regulatory differences helps UK gamblers choose wisely about where they opt in online casino gaming.

What British Players Should Consider Before Switching
Before committing to non uk casinos, British players must carefully evaluate licensing credentials and compliance standards from reputable jurisdictions like Malta, Gibraltar, or Curacao. Understanding payment methods, withdrawal times, and currency conversion fees becomes essential when operating outside UK banking systems. Players should also confirm whether customer support operates in their timezone and whether dispute resolution mechanisms exist beyond UK regulatory protections.
Security protocols warrant thorough investigation, as non uk casinos may not follow the identical privacy safeguards required under UK regulations. Gambling protection tools could differ substantially from well-known GAMSTOP protections, requiring players to exercise greater self-control. Tax consequences on winnings need to be researched, alongside understanding how these platforms address player grievances and if they maintain transparent operational histories.
